Tips for Enhancing Your Dream Recall and Interpretation

If you’re interested in exploring the meanings of your dreams further, here are some tips to help you remember and interpret them more effectively:

  1. Keep a dream journal: Write down your dreams as soon as you wake up, including any details, emotions, and symbols that stand out to you.
  2. Set an intention: Before going to sleep, set an intention to remember your dreams and gain insight from them. This can help prime your subconscious mind to be more receptive to dream messages.
  3. Practice good sleep hygiene: Create a comfortable, relaxing sleep environment and establish a consistent sleep schedule to promote better dream recall.
  4. Meditate or practice relaxation techniques: Engaging in practices like meditation, deep breathing, or progressive muscle relaxation before bed can help quiet your mind and enhance your dream experiences.
  5. Explore dream symbolism: Familiarize yourself with common dream symbols and their meanings, but remember that your personal associations and life experiences will also influence your interpretations.
  6. Share your dreams with others: Discussing your dreams with friends, family, or a dream group can provide new perspectives and insights into their meanings.
